Machame Route Itinerary

Machame Route - Day 1

You will be transported, with your lead guide, from your hotel to the start of your challenge at Machame Gate where you will meet your local guides and porters.  You will then set off from the Gate to walk to your first overnight camp at Machame Camp.  Walking through lush Rainforest, we will stop for lunch before continuing on to the camp. After reaching camp, you will be provided with hot drinks and hot water for washing before settling down for dinner prepared by your camp chef.

Camp elevation: 2,980m

Elevation gain: 1,490m

Distance trekked: 18km

Trekking time: 5-7 hours

Machame Route - Day 2

We will wake you up with hot water to wash with before breakfast. After you have eaten, we will leave Machame Camp to make our way to Shira Camp. You will again walk through some Rainforest before crossing a valley along a steep rocky ridge, stopping for lunch along the way.  You then continue along a river gorge until you reach your overnight stay at Shira Camp. You will again be given hot water to wash with before settling down to a hot dinner.

Camp elevation: 3850m

Elevation gain: 870m

Distance trekked: 9km

Trekking time: 4-6 hours

Machame Route - Day 3

We again wake you up to hot water followed by breakfast. Today is an acclimatisation day. As well as making progress, we use today to take you to Lava Tower at an elevation of 4,650m for lunch, before returning to a lower elevation at Barranco Camp. Although you will not gain much height today, it is important for your acclimatisation to altitude which will help you on your summit day.  Todays trek will be through a rocky, vegetation filled landscape. After reaching Barranco Camp, you will again be given hot water to wash with before dinner.

Camp Elevation: 3950m

Elevation gain: 100m

Distance trekked: 15km

Treking time: 6-7 hours

Machame Route - Day 4

After breakfast, we set off to the Barranco Wall and then through the Karanga Valley before before stopping for lunch.  We then make our way up to Barafu Camp for your next overnight stay. You will again have hot water to wash with before dinner and then a very early night as you will be woken very early to start your summit attempt.

Camp Elevation: 4,700m

Elevation gain: 750m

Distance trekked: 13km

Trekking time: 7-8 hours

Machame Route - Day 5

Today is summit day!  You will be woken at midnight with a hot drink and a quick breakfast before setting off up the scree slopes to the summit.  We will zig zag in darkness using our head torches.  Our aim is to reach Stella Point for the amazing Sunrise over Africa.  This is one of the most stunning sights you will see on your whole adventure.  After a short stop, we will continue on along the rim of the volcano to Uhuru Peak, the summit of Africa at 5,895m.  After your photos by the summit sign, we will descend back to Barafu Camp for food and a short rest.  We will then contine down to Mweka Camp for your last overnight camp on the mountain.  You will again have hot water before dinner.

Camp elevation: 3,100m

Elevation gain: 1,295m ascent, 2,795m descent

Distance trekked: 30km (7km up and 23km down)

Trekking time: 15-16 hours

Machame Route - Day 6

After a well deserved good nights sleep, you will awake to hot water for washing and then breakfast. We then set off to complete the challenge at Machame Gate.  We will have a celebration and say goodbye to our guides and porters before being transported back to our hotel.  You can now have a hot shower and relax before our celebratory dinner where you will be presented with your certificates.

Gate elevation: 1,490m

Elevation loss: 1,610m

Distance trekked: 15km

Trekking time: 4-5 hours

 

What is included

All of our Kilimanjaro challenges include the following:

-Transfers to and from the Airport

-Hotel accommodation on your first and last night

-All park fees

-All fees for guides, porters and support staff

-All food on the mountain including breakfast, lunch and dinner

-All camping equipment, excluding personal kit

 

Whats NOT included

-Flights to and from Tanzania International Airport

-Visa fees, payable on arrival

-Travel insurance
